Decisions on 30 July and 7 October 2022 under-frequency events

  • Compliance

In August 2023, the Electricity Authority consulted on its draft determinations for two under-frequency events on 30 July and 7 October 2022.

Our final determinations are that:

  • Genesis Energy Limited was the causer of the under-frequency event on 30 July 2022
  • Transpower New Zealand Limited was the causer of the under-frequency event on 7 October 2022.

Read the reasons for our determinations.

If a substantially affected participant would like to dispute these final determinations, they can provide a written notice to the Rulings Panel within 10 business days after the publication of this decision.

Notices should be sent to registrar@electricityrulingspanel.nz by 5pm on 13 November 2023.
